js数据转树形结构

    dataTOTree (data,val) {
      const map = {};
      data.forEach((item) => {
          map[item.currentNode] = item;
      });
      data.forEach((item) => {
          const parent = map[item.parentNode];
          if (parent) {
              (parent.children || (parent.children = [])).push(item);
          } else {
              val.push(item);
          }
      });
    }
原文地址:https://www.cnblogs.com/lintu-kong/p/14191728.html